akka.cluster.protobuf.msg
Class ClusterMessages.MetricsGossip.Builder

java.lang.Object
  extended by 
      extended by akka.cluster.protobuf.msg.ClusterMessages.MetricsGossip.Builder
All Implemented Interfaces:
ClusterMessages.MetricsGossipOrBuilder
Enclosing class:
ClusterMessages.MetricsGossip

public static final class ClusterMessages.MetricsGossip.Builder
extends
implements ClusterMessages.MetricsGossipOrBuilder

Protobuf type MetricsGossip

 Metrics Gossip
 


Method Summary
 ClusterMessages.MetricsGossip.Builder addAllAddresses(ClusterMessages.Address.Builder builderForValue)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der addAllAddresses(ClusterMessages.Address value)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der addAllAddresses(int index, ClusterMessages.Address.Builder builderForValue)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der addAllAddresses(int index, ClusterMessages.Address value)
          repeated .Address allAddresses = 1;
 ClusterMessages.Address.Builder addAllAddressesBuilder()
          repeated .Address allAddresses = 1;
 ClusterMessages.Address.Builder addAllAddressesBuilder(int index)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der addAllAllAddresses(java.lang.Iterable<? extends ClusterMessages.Address> values)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der addAllAllMetricNames(java.lang.Iterable<java.lang.String> values)
          repeated string allMetricNames = 2;
 ClusterMessages.MetricsGossip.Builder addAllMetricNames(java.lang.String value)
          repeated string allMetricNames = 2;
 ClusterMessages.MetricsGossip.Builder addAllMetricNamesBytes(com.google.protobuf.ByteString value)
          repeated string allMetricNames = 2;
 ClusterMessages.MetricsGossip.Builder addAllNodeMetrics(java.lang.Iterable<? extends ClusterMessages.NodeMetrics> values)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ip.Builder addNodeMetrics(ClusterMessages.NodeMetrics.Builder builderForValue)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ip.Builder addNodeMetrics(ClusterMessages.NodeMetrics value)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ip.Builder addNodeMetrics(int index, ClusterMessages.NodeMetrics.Builder builderForValue)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ip.Builder addNodeMetrics(int index, ClusterMessages.NodeMetrics value)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.NodeMetrics.Builder addNodeMetricsBuilder()
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.NodeMetrics.Builder addNodeMetricsBuilder(int index)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ip build()
           
 ClusterMessages.MetricsGossip buildPartial()
           
 ClusterMessages.MetricsGossip.Builder clear()
           
 ClusterMessages.MetricsGossip.Builder clearAllAddresses()
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der clearAllMetricNames()
          repeated string allMetricNames = 2;
 ClusterMessages.MetricsGossip.Builder clearNodeMetrics()
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ip.Builder clone()
           
 ClusterMessages.Address getAllAddresses(int index)
          repeated .Address allAddresses = 1;
 ClusterMessages.Address.Builder getAllAddressesBuilder(int index)
          repeated .Address allAddresses = 1;
 java.util.List<ClusterMessages.Address.Builder> getAllAddressesBuilderList()
          repeated .Address allAddresses = 1;
 int getAllAddressesCount()
          repeated .Address allAddresses = 1;
 java.util.List<ClusterMessages.Address> getAllAddressesList()
          repeated .Address allAddresses = 1;
 ClusterMessages.AddressOrBuilder getAllAddressesOrBuilder(int index)
          repeated .Address allAddresses = 1;
 java.util.List<? extends ClusterMessages.AddressOrBuilder> getAllAddressesOrBuilderList()
          repeated .Address allAddresses = 1;
 java.lang.String getAllMetricNames(int index)
          repeated string allMetricNames = 2;
 com.google.protobuf.ByteString getAllMetricNamesBytes(int index)
          repeated string allMetricNames = 2;
 int getAllMetricNamesCount()
          repeated string allMetricNames = 2;
 java.util.List<java.lang.String> getAllMetricNamesList()
          repeated string allMetricNames = 2;
 ClusterMessages.MetricsGossip getDefaultInstanceForType()
           
static com.google.protobuf.Descriptors.Descriptor getDescriptor()
           
 com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
           
 ClusterMessages.NodeMetrics getNodeMetrics(int index)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.NodeMetrics.Builder getNodeMetricsBuilder(int index)
          repeated .NodeMetrics nodeMetrics = 3;
 java.util.List<ClusterMessages.NodeMetrics.Builder> getNodeMetricsBuilderList()
          repeated .NodeMetrics nodeMetrics = 3;
 int getNodeMetricsCount()
          repeated .NodeMetrics nodeMetrics = 3;
 java.util.List<ClusterMessages.NodeMetrics> getNodeMetricsList()
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.NodeMetricsOrBuilder getNodeMetricsOrBuilder(int index)
          repeated .NodeMetrics nodeMetrics = 3;
 java.util.List<? extends ClusterMessages.NodeMetricsOrBuilder> getNodeMetricsOrBuilderList()
          repeated .NodeMetrics nodeMetrics = 3;
protected  com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
           
 boolean isInitialized()
           
 ClusterMessages.MetricsGossip.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
           
 ClusterMessages.MetricsGossip.Builder mergeFrom(com.google.protobuf.Message other)
           
 ClusterMessages.MetricsGossip.Builder removeAllAddresses(int index)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der removeNodeMetrics(int index)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ip.Builder setAllAddresses(int index, ClusterMessages.Address.Builder builderForValue)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der setAllAddresses(int index, ClusterMessages.Address value)
          repeated .Address allAddresses = 1;
 ClusterMessages.MetricsGossip.Builder setAllMetricNames(int index, java.lang.String value)
          repeated string allMetricNames = 2;
 ClusterMessages.MetricsGossip.Builder setNodeMetrics(int index, ClusterMessages.NodeMetrics.Builder builderForValue)
          repeated .NodeMetrics nodeMetrics = 3;
 ClusterMessages.MetricsGossip.Builder setNodeMetrics(int index, ClusterMessages.NodeMetrics value)
          repeated .NodeMetrics nodeMetrics = 3;
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

getDescriptor

public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()

internalGetFieldAccessorTable

prot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()

clear

public ClusterMessages.MetricsGossip.Builder clear()

clone

public ClusterMessages.MetricsGossip.Builder clone()

getDescriptorForType

public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()

getDefaultInstanceForType

public ClusterMessages.MetricsGossip getDefaultInstanceForType()

build

public ClusterMessages.MetricsGossip build()

buildPartial

public ClusterMessages.MetricsGossip buildPartial()

mergeFrom

public ClusterMessages.MetricsGossip.Builder mergeFrom(com.google.protobuf.Message other)

isInitialized

public final boolean isInitialized()

mergeFrom

public ClusterMessages.MetricsGossip.Builder mergeFrom(com.google.protobuf.CodedInputStream input,
                                                       com.google.protobuf.ExtensionRegistryLite extensionRegistry)
                                                throws java.io.IOException
Throws:
java.io.IOException

getAllAddressesList

public java.util.List<ClusterMessages.Address> getAllAddressesList()
repeated .Address allAddresses = 1;

Specified by:
getAllAddressesList in interface ClusterMessages.MetricsGossipOrBuilder

getAllAddressesCount

public int getAllAddressesCount()
repeated .Address allAddresses = 1;

Specified by:
getAllAddressesCount in interface ClusterMessages.MetricsGossipOrBuilder

getAllAddresses

public ClusterMessages.Address getAllAddresses(int index)
repeated .Address allAddresses = 1;

Specified by:
getAllAddresses in interface ClusterMessages.MetricsGossipOrBuilder

setAllAddresses

public ClusterMessages.MetricsGossip.Builder setAllAddresses(int index,
                                                             ClusterMessages.Address value)
repeated .Address allAddresses = 1;


setAllAddresses

public ClusterMessages.MetricsGossip.Builder setAllAddresses(int index,
                                                             ClusterMessages.Address.Builder builderForValue)
repeated .Address allAddresses = 1;


addAllAddresses

public ClusterMessages.MetricsGossip.Builder addAllAddresses(ClusterMessages.Address value)
repeated .Address allAddresses = 1;


addAllAddresses

public ClusterMessages.MetricsGossip.Builder addAllAddresses(int index,
                                                             ClusterMessages.Address value)
repeated .Address allAddresses = 1;


addAllAddresses

public ClusterMessages.MetricsGossip.Builder addAllAddresses(ClusterMessages.Address.Builder builderForValue)
repeated .Address allAddresses = 1;


addAllAddresses

public ClusterMessages.MetricsGossip.Builder addAllAddresses(int index,
                                                             ClusterMessages.Address.Builder builderForValue)
repeated .Address allAddresses = 1;


addAllAllAddresses

public ClusterMessages.MetricsGossip.Builder addAllAllAddresses(java.lang.Iterable<? extends ClusterMessages.Address> values)
repeated .Address allAddresses = 1;


clearAllAddresses

public ClusterMessages.MetricsGossip.Builder clearAllAddresses()
repeated .Address allAddresses = 1;


removeAllAddresses

public ClusterMessages.MetricsGossip.Builder removeAllAddresses(int index)
repeated .Address allAddresses = 1;


getAllAddressesBuilder

public ClusterMessages.Address.Builder getAllAddressesBuilder(int index)
repeated .Address allAddresses = 1;


getAllAddressesOrBuilder

public ClusterMessages.AddressOrBuilder getAllAddressesOrBuilder(int index)
repeated .Address allAddresses = 1;

Specified by:
getAllAddressesOrBuilder in interface ClusterMessages.MetricsGossipOrBuilder

getAllAddressesOrBuilderList

public java.util.List<? extends ClusterMessages.AddressOrBuilder> getAllAddressesOrBuilderList()
repeated .Address allAddresses = 1;

Specified by:
getAllAddressesOrBuilderList in interface ClusterMessages.MetricsGossipOrBuilder

addAllAddressesBuilder

public ClusterMessages.Address.Builder addAllAddressesBuilder()
repeated .Address allAddresses = 1;


addAllAddressesBuilder

public ClusterMessages.Address.Builder addAllAddressesBuilder(int index)
repeated .Address allAddresses = 1;


getAllAddressesBuilderList

public java.util.List<ClusterMessages.Address.Builder> getAllAddressesBuilderList()
repeated .Address allAddresses = 1;


getAllMetricNamesList

public java.util.List<java.lang.String> getAllMetricNamesList()
repeated string allMetricNames = 2;

Specified by:
getAllMetricNamesList in interface ClusterMessages.MetricsGossipOrBuilder

getAllMetricNamesCount

public int getAllMetricNamesCount()
repeated string allMetricNames = 2;

Specified by:
getAllMetricNamesCount in interface ClusterMessages.MetricsGossipOrBuilder

getAllMetricNames

public java.lang.String getAllMetricNames(int index)
repeated string allMetricNames = 2;

Specified by:
getAllMetricNames in interface ClusterMessages.MetricsGossipOrBuilder

getAllMetricNamesBytes

public com.google.protobuf.ByteString getAllMetricNamesBytes(int index)
repeated string allMetricNames = 2;

Specified by:
getAllMetricNamesBytes in interface ClusterMessages.MetricsGossipOrBuilder

setAllMetricNames

public ClusterMessages.MetricsGossip.Builder setAllMetricNames(int index,
                                                               java.lang.String value)
repeated string allMetricNames = 2;


addAllMetricNames

public ClusterMessages.MetricsGossip.Builder addAllMetricNames(java.lang.String value)
repeated string allMetricNames = 2;


addAllAllMetricNames

public ClusterMessages.MetricsGossip.Builder addAllAllMetricNames(java.lang.Iterable<java.lang.String> values)
repeated string allMetricNames = 2;


clearAllMetricNames

public ClusterMessages.MetricsGossip.Builder clearAllMetricNames()
repeated string allMetricNames = 2;


addAllMetricNamesBytes

public ClusterMessages.MetricsGossip.Builder addAllMetricNamesBytes(com.google.protobuf.ByteString value)
repeated string allMetricNames = 2;


getNodeMetricsList

public java.util.List<ClusterMessages.NodeMetrics> getNodeMetricsList()
repeated .NodeMetrics nodeMetrics = 3;

Specified by:
getNodeMetricsList in interface ClusterMessages.MetricsGossipOrBuilder

getNodeMetricsCount

public int getNodeMetricsCount()
repeated .NodeMetrics nodeMetrics = 3;

Specified by:
getNodeMetricsCount in interface ClusterMessages.MetricsGossipOrBuilder

getNodeMetrics

public ClusterMessages.NodeMetrics getNodeMetrics(int index)
repeated .NodeMetrics nodeMetrics = 3;

Specified by:
getNodeMetrics in interface ClusterMessages.MetricsGossipOrBuilder

setNodeMetrics

public ClusterMessages.MetricsGossip.Builder setNodeMetrics(int index,
                                                            ClusterMessages.NodeMetrics value)
repeated .NodeMetrics nodeMetrics = 3;


setNodeMetrics

public ClusterMessages.MetricsGossip.Builder setNodeMetrics(int index,
                                                            ClusterMessages.NodeMetrics.Builder builderForValue)
repeated .NodeMetrics nodeMetrics = 3;


addNodeMetrics

public ClusterMessages.MetricsGossip.Builder addNodeMetrics(ClusterMessages.NodeMetrics value)
repeated .NodeMetrics nodeMetrics = 3;


addNodeMetrics

public ClusterMessages.MetricsGossip.Builder addNodeMetrics(int index,
                                                            ClusterMessages.NodeMetrics value)
repeated .NodeMetrics nodeMetrics = 3;


addNodeMetrics

public ClusterMessages.MetricsGossip.Builder addNodeMetrics(ClusterMessages.NodeMetrics.Builder builderForValue)
repeated .NodeMetrics nodeMetrics = 3;


addNodeMetrics

public ClusterMessages.MetricsGossip.Builder addNodeMetrics(int index,
                                                            ClusterMessages.NodeMetrics.Builder builderForValue)
repeated .NodeMetrics nodeMetrics = 3;


addAllNodeMetrics

public ClusterMessages.MetricsGossip.Builder addAllNodeMetrics(java.lang.Iterable<? extends ClusterMessages.NodeMetrics> values)
repeated .NodeMetrics nodeMetrics = 3;


clearNodeMetrics

public ClusterMessages.MetricsGossip.Builder clearNodeMetrics()
repeated .NodeMetrics nodeMetrics = 3;


removeNodeMetrics

public ClusterMessages.MetricsGossip.Builder removeNodeMetrics(int index)
repeated .NodeMetrics nodeMetrics = 3;


getNodeMetricsBuilder

public ClusterMessages.NodeMetrics.Builder getNodeMetricsBuilder(int index)
repeated .NodeMetrics nodeMetrics = 3;


getNodeMetricsOrBuilder

public ClusterMessages.NodeMetricsOrBuilder getNodeMetricsOrBuilder(int index)
repeated .NodeMetrics nodeMetrics = 3;

Specified by:
getNodeMetricsOrBuilder in interface ClusterMessages.MetricsGossipOrBuilder

getNodeMetricsOrBuilderList

public java.util.List<? extends ClusterMessages.NodeMetricsOrBuilder> getNodeMetricsOrBuilderList()
repeated .NodeMetrics nodeMetrics = 3;

Specified by:
getNodeMetricsOrBuilderList in interface ClusterMessages.MetricsGossipOrBuilder

addNodeMetricsBuilder

public ClusterMessages.NodeMetrics.Builder addNodeMetricsBuilder()
repeated .NodeMetrics nodeMetrics = 3;


addNodeMetricsBuilder

public ClusterMessages.NodeMetrics.Builder addNodeMetricsBuilder(int index)
repeated .NodeMetrics nodeMetrics = 3;


getNodeMetricsBuilderList

public java.util.List<ClusterMessages.NodeMetrics.Builder> getNodeMetricsBuilderList()
repeated .NodeMetrics nodeMetrics = 3;